Designer Bags: A Brief Background

As women began to work outside the home and began to gain more independence in the 1900s, handbags became fashionable as well as a useful tool to carry makeup, money and other essentials. Bags evolved over time, from bags worn around the waist of Ancient Egypt to what we call designer handbags.

It was in the 1950s when bags transformed from being practical to a status symbol as more designers came onto the market. Chanel, Louis Vuitton and Hermes quickly gained a reputation as designers of beautiful and bold bags. They were sought-after by the elite. The popularity of designer bags resulted in the creation of iconic designs that are still seen in many outfits in the present.

During WWII purse designs changed slightly because manufacturers made use of less metal and other materials in the production of bags needed for war. The closing of the war brought a new era of freedom for young people, and rules about what could be carried around by women became looser. Bags that were previously considered unfashionable, such as drawstring bags made of plastic or wicker, became fashionable as women were free to experiment with their own style.

The 60s witnessed the rise of hippie culture and youth attitudes that influenced fashion trends, and a plethora of new bag designs were invented. Designers took advantage of the creativity of the time by creating bags in leather, vinyl chains, chains, and even chainmail. Many of these modern styles were inspired by Op Art, space travel and the libertine, carefree attitude of the era.

In the 1990s, designer bags were back in fashion and became a significant element of the fashion industry. Many designers reworked classic silhouettes such as the structured, boxy bag to create more contemporary and sleek styles. YSL's Muse bag, for example was a huge success in the decade and is still found on the arm of models and celebrities today.
